Sec. 51-164r. Failure to pay or plead. (a) Any person charged with an infraction
who fails to pay the fine and any additional fee imposed or send in his plea of not guilty
by the answer date or wilfully fails to appear for any scheduled court appearance date
which may be required shall be guilty of a class C misdemeanor.
(P.A. 76-381, S. 2; P.A. 79-534, S. 5; May Sp. Sess. P.A. 92-6, S. 75, 117; P.A. 93-141, S. 4.)
History: P.A. 79-534 added reference to additional fees; May Sp. Sess. P.A. 92-6 added new Subsec. (b) to provide that failure to pay fines and additional fees pursuant to Sec. 51-164n or submit a not guilty plea by the answer date or appear for any trial is guilty of a class A misdemeanor; P.A. 93-141 added "wilfully fails" before "to appear" and changed "trial" to "scheduled court appearance".
